Job description

Reporting to the Overhead Line Design Lead or Lead Design Engineer, you will be responsible for developing and delivering engineering solutions from feasibility to detailed engineering design for Transmission networks projects (132kV and above).

This will include providing the necessary design calculations, reports, drawings and defining, developing and maintaining standards for OHL installation works and providing effective technical support, advice and input throughout the lifecycle of the project within Scottish Power Transmission Projects.

Responsibilities

Responsible for the development of pre-contract design and delivery of projects by developing the technical aspects of OHL systems and all other associated equipment, you will perform all duties coupled with promoting, internally and externally, a strong emphasis on Health, Safety, Quality, Environmental compliance and continuous improvement.

Assessing engineering documentation, feasibility and compliance to meet client requirements and support the preparation of accurate budgets for new projects, you will recommend construction and outage programmes where required in relation to OHL circuits.

Responsible for preparing basic and detailed engineering specifications for OHL system designs and costs for high value, complex or business critical projects, you will also drive resolution of statutory, land or other consents regarding OHL routes, providing technical assessment of tender submissions and reporting recommendations.

Defining OHL equipment requirements for input to System Construction Authorisation (SCA), Project Technical Specifications and BETTA documentation, you will prepare and review OHL drawings and technical specifications for Construction, Procurement or other stakeholders.

Controlling correspondence and drawings to be issued to the Project Delivery and Pre-Contract teams, you will ensure specifications, OHL system designs, equipment and construction practices are in accordance with current legislation, policies and operational requirements whilst leading the technical resolution of Site/Construction OHL related issues.

Why SP Energy Networks

SP Energy Networks is part of the Iberdrola Group, one of the world’s largest integrated utility companies and a world leader in wind energy. We keep electricity flowing to homes and businesses through Central and Southern Scotland, North Wales and in the North West of England. We operate over 4000km of cables and lines that make-up the transmission network – connecting infrastructure like wind farms into the electricity system. It’s a role that puts us right at the heart of Scotland’s ambition to be Net Zero by 2044. And we’re taking it very seriously.

We’re investing >£5.5 billion into our transmission network, directly supporting the rapid growth needed in renewable energy.
